Job Description:

At Ameren’s Innovation Center, the Innovation Intern position supports challenging projects and conducts research in areas of advanced technology that contributes toward the Company’s strategic investment in forward-thinking initiatives. Interns gain valuable work experience in various aspects of technology research & development within a large Fortune 500 energy company.

The Innovation Center is comprised of groups of interdisciplinary (technical & non-technical) students working on projects in the areas of data analytics, application development, and emerging technology research. As an Innovation Intern, you will have the opportunity to support planning, execution, and completion of various initiatives.
